How to make a Flexagon
First, you need to make your template.
The template is on the next page.
Second, cut AROUND the two pieces on the outline.
There will be 2 pieces with 19 triangles each.
Third, Make a double thickness by folding each piece in half and GLUING them shut. There should be 1 triangle that is NOT glued on each piece.
Fourth, glue the 2 strips together in a straight line by gluing the 2 triangles together.
Fifth, fold back and forth on ALL the lines and for ALL triangles.
Place the strip of 19 triangles with the side showing 6’s, 5’s and 4’s and the glue tab, *, to the left.
Fold the strip back on itself matching two 6’s, 5’s or 4’s that are next to each other and do that for the entire strip.
Now you have a strip of 10 triangles.
Place the strip without glue tabs (without these : *) facing up and with the “3” tab to the left. Fold BACK on the line between the third and forth triangles (2 and 1) — on the back four 2’s are together now. Flip the paper over. Fold BACK on the line where the next 2 and 1 meet. Now you should be able to see five 2’s.
Pull the 2 forward that is behind the 3. There should be six 2’s on top and one 1 to the side. Fold the 1 back and flip over. Now you should be able to see that the two glue tabs marked * are face-to-face. Glue them together.
Wait a little bit of time before flexing your flexagon.
How to flex your flexagon :
Fold the flexagon to bring three alternate corners together. The top of the flexagon will pop open if there is a new face to reveal. If it doesn’t pop open, flatten and try again with the other 3 corners.
